Would you like to go to https://onsiter.com/us/ instead?
Saattaa olla saatavilla
(Päivitetty 2024-04-19)QA Consultant
København, Danmark
Äidinkieli Danish, English
- Quality Assurance
- Agile Testing
- ISTQB Certified
Taidot (20)
Test
Confluence
Jira/Confluence
Azure DevOps
QUALITY ASSURANCE
Test Design and Analysis
Tester
Azure DevOps
ISTQB certification
ISTQB
Test Techniques
Agile Testing
Test methods and techniques
Jira
SDLC
XML
JavaScript
Test Automation
API Testing
Test Reporting
Yhteenveto
Experienced and pragmatic QA Consultant. Customers include Topdanmark, Danske Handicaporganisationer, RealTime LCA and others. Experience in working in various software development lifecycles, including agile, waterfall and a hybrid setup.
Adept at ensuring software quality and reliability through risk based testing, test design and methods, and meticulous manual and automated testing. Skilled in developing and executing test scripts using JavaScript, optimizing testing processes for efficiency. Proficient in testing at all levels and types (functional and non-functional), employing various techniques such as equivalence partitioning and boundary value testing to uncover potential issues.
Collaborative team player with expertise in Agile methodologies, leveraging tools like Jira/Confluence, Azure DevOps and others for effective test management and documentation.
Committed to delivering high-quality software products by adhering to rigorous testing standards and contributing to cross-functional team success.
Työkokemus
2022-04 - Nykyhetki
In my role as a QA Associate, I was entrusted with ensuring the quality and reliability of software products through a blend of manual and automated testing methodologies. I meticulously conducted manual test flows, following predefined test cases and scenarios to identify any defects and ensure the software met functional requirements and user expectations. Simultaneously, I leveraged test automation, utilizing JavaScript to develop and implement automated test scripts, thereby streamlining repetitive testing processes and enhancing efficiency.
End-to-end testing was a crucial aspect of my role, wherein I meticulously validated the entire software system from start to finish, ensuring seamless integration and functionality of all components. To achieve this, I engaged in thorough test analysis and design, deriving comprehensive test plans and strategies from functional requirements. Throughout the process, I applied various test techniques such as equivalence partitioning, boundary value testing, decision trees, and CRUD testing to uncover potential issues and edge cases.
Working within an Agile environment, I collaborated closely with cross-functional teams, participating in Agile ceremonies to ensure continuous integration and delivery of high-quality software. Additionally, I relied on tools like Jira and Confluence for effective test management, tracking, and documentation, maintaining detailed records of test cases, defects, and project progress. This multifaceted approach allowed me to fulfill my responsibilities as a QA Associate, contributing to the overall success and quality of software projects.
2022-01 - 2022-04
In my role as a Senior Test Specialist, I was deeply involved in Agile testing practices, seamlessly integrating testing into the iterative development process. This involved collaborating closely with cross-functional teams, participating in Agile ceremonies, and adapting testing strategies to fit the Agile framework. I ensured that testing activities were aligned with sprint goals and contributed to the overall delivery of high-quality software.
I conducted various test types to comprehensively assess the software's functionality and performance. System testing allowed me to evaluate the software as a whole, ensuring that all components worked together seamlessly. Integration testing focused on verifying the interactions between different modules or systems, while user acceptance testing gauged whether the software met the end user's requirements and expectations. Additionally, usability testing provided valuable insights into the user experience, identifying areas for improvement in terms of accessibility, navigation, and overall usability.
To enhance testing coverage and effectiveness, I employed a variety of test techniques. Boundary value testing helped identify potential errors at the boundaries of input ranges, while equivalence testing enabled efficient test case design by partitioning input values into equivalent classes. Decision tree testing provided a structured approach to identifying test scenarios based on decision points within the software.
Throughout these testing activities, I prioritized thorough test analysis and design, ensuring that test plans and strategies effectively addressed the software's functional requirements and potential areas of risk. Test reporting and management were also integral parts of my role, as I documented test results and communicated them to relevant stakeholders to facilitate informed decision-making.
Moreover, I took on the responsibility of mentoring and guiding new testers, sharing best practices and techniques to help them excel in their roles and contribute effectively to the testing process.
Overall, my role as a QA Associate encompassed a comprehensive range of responsibilities, from Agile testing and various test types to test techniques and mentoring, all aimed at delivering high-quality software products that met user needs and expectations.
2020-01 - 2022-01
In my capacity as a QA Associate, Agile testing was at the forefront of my responsibilities, ensuring that testing activities seamlessly integrated into the Agile development process. Collaborating closely with cross-functional teams, I actively participated in Agile ceremonies to align testing efforts with sprint goals and project objectives. This iterative approach allowed for continuous feedback and adaptation, enhancing the overall quality of the software.
Central to my role was test analysis and design, where I meticulously examined functional requirements to develop comprehensive test plans and strategies. By employing methods such as decision trees, equivalence testing, and boundary testing, I ensured that test coverage was thorough and targeted, addressing various scenarios and potential edge cases.
API testing played a crucial role in validating the functionality and reliability of the software's interfaces. I conducted thorough API tests to verify endpoints, payloads, and responses, ensuring seamless communication between different system components. As part of API testing, I also performed CRUD (Create, Read, Update, Delete) tests to validate the fundamental operations of the API.
Functional testing was another key aspect of my responsibilities, focusing on validating the software against specified functional requirements. This involved creating test cases to verify individual functions and features, as well as conducting negative testing to assess how the system behaved under adverse conditions.
System testing allowed for the comprehensive evaluation of the software as a whole, ensuring that all components worked together seamlessly to deliver the intended functionality. Integration testing further verified the interactions between different modules or systems, identifying and resolving any integration issues.
Throughout these testing activities, I emphasized the importance of thorough documentation and reporting, ensuring that all test results were accurately recorded and communicated to relevant stakeholders. This facilitated informed decision-making and provided insights into the overall quality of the software.
In summary, my role as a QA Associate encompassed a diverse range of responsibilities, from Agile testing and test analysis to API testing, functional testing, system testing, integration testing, and the use of various testing methods. By leveraging these techniques and methodologies, I contributed to the delivery of high-quality software products that met user needs and exceeded expectations.
2019-01 - 2019-12
In my capacity as a Usability Test Specialist, I ensured that the application under test was not only user-friendly but also aligned with the needs of its intended users while meeting essential quality characteristics. This process commenced with a meticulous requirement analysis, involving user research and stakeholder interviews to grasp project objectives and user goals thoroughly.
I further validated these requirements through user acceptance tests and usability tests, ensuring their feasibility and alignment with user needs and quality characteristics. Key to this process was user research and visualization of requirements, where I delved into user preferences, behaviors, user flows, and pain points through various methods, including creating user personas, conducting surveys, and observing user interactions.
These comprehensive efforts were aimed at guaranteeing that the final product not only met the specified requirements but also delivered an optimal user experience in line with quality characteristics.
Koulutus
2023-06 - 2013-01
2017-01 - 2019-01
Sertifikaatit
2020-11
Ota yhteyttä konsulttiin
Tarvitsetko apua asiantuntijan löytämisessä?
Voimme yhdistää sinut vaatimukset täyttäviin kokeneisiin asiantuntijoihin.
tai